Homemade Baked Beans Flavor (Printer-Friendly Version)

Thick, smoky beans with bacon, molasses, and maple syrup for rich, comforting cookout flavors.

# Ingredients Needed:

→ Meat

01 - 8 strips of raw bacon

→ Vegetables

02 - 1 medium onion, finely chopped

→ Canned Goods

03 - 3 cans (16 oz each) pork and beans

→ Condiments & Sweeteners

04 - 3 tablespoons yellow mustard
05 - 3 tablespoons maple syrup
06 - 3 tablespoons ketchup
07 - 1 tablespoon molasses
08 - 1/4 cup packed light brown sugar

→ Spices & Seasonings

09 - 1/2 teaspoon salt
10 - 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

# Step-by-Step Directions:

01 - In a large skillet, fry bacon over medium heat until crisp. Remove bacon and drain on paper towels, reserving 1/4 cup of bacon grease in the skillet.
02 - Add chopped onion to the reserved bacon grease and sauté over medium heat until translucent. If there is insufficient grease, add a small amount of oil.
03 - Stir in pork and beans, mustard, maple syrup, ketchup, molasses, brown sugar, salt, pepper, and crumbled bacon into the skillet with the onions. Mix thoroughly.
04 - Transfer the mixture to an ungreased 9×13-inch baking dish and cover with aluminum foil.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 60 minutes until bubbly and browned.
05 - For thicker texture, remove the foil and continue baking uncovered for an additional 20 to 30 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ir before serving.

# Helpful Hints:

01 - These beans can be prepared up to 3 days in advance and stored covered in the refrigerator. Reheat in the oven before serving.
02 - To increase thickness, extend cooking time uncovered until the desired consistency is reached.
